The AFV ASSOCIATION was formed in 1964 to support the thoughts and research of all those interested in Armored Fighting Vehicles and related topics, such as AFV drawings. The emphasis has always been on sharing information and communicating with other members of similar interests; e.g. German armor, Japanese AFVs, or whatever.

Post subject: Trieste, Museo Diego de Henriquez: StuG III

This tank isn't in a great shape. It clearly has broken tension bars and the engine's covers seems fake (hiding a damaged interior?). Fittings and fenders have seen better days too.

This time I feel Pierre Olivier will pick the same picture I would chose myself, there is a shot that is, in my opinion, just better than the rest. Let's see if I am right this time Mr. Green

In that place it's very difficult to take a good, old, three-quarter front view; I had to use a wide-angle for that.
